Last night my tv's capacitor has blown off of 160v 47 uf and as it's not available in store so person gave me capacitor of 160v and 100 uf so it's it okay to go with it.
 
Solution
Given a choice, I'd go for one of the same capacitance (47µF) and higher voltage. The capacitance may be important to the function of the circuit as it will affect things like resonant frequencies.

That said, a relatively-high-value (probably electrolytic) capacitor like this is likely to be used for power supply decoupling or smoothing rather than in an oscillator or filter so a higher value should be OK.
